**Mgmt Meeting Minutes — Retiring the Brightline Range**

Quick recap for sales leads at Fenholt Supplies: we agreed to retire the Brightline fixture range by year-end. Remaining stock moves to clearance pricing next month, and accounts on standing orders get migrated to the Lumetta range. Trade-in incentives were approved in principle. The confidential note on next steps sits just below.

board note of bajof-bajeg: The pricing group signed off on a budget of $13.4 million for Project Sildor. The renewal with Lamixek Holdings closes at $48.9 million a year, 49 percent above the last contract.

Minutes — Management Meeting

Prepared for the incoming director. Topic: possible acquisition of Greyfen Analytics. Due diligence 70% complete. Valuation gap remains; Greyfen seeks a premium. Integration risks flagged by Ops. Decision deferred to next month. Talla Nyberg leads negotiations. Our walk-away position is stated below.

board note of fawig-kagup: Only 48 of the 435 pilot accounts renewed Rusion, so a churn review is set for September 12. Fenwynox Logistics is in early talks to buy Sorielek Systems for about $117.8 million.

## Step 4 — Register Your Plugin with TileForge Cache

Plugin authors deploying against the TileForge cache layer must register their extension bundle before the cache nodes will accept render callbacks. Build your bundle with the provided toolchain, verify checksums locally, and confirm compatibility with cache protocol version 3. Registration requires a signed manifest; unsigned manifests are silently dropped by the Harrowfield edge nodes. The deploy key to use when signing your manifest appears below.

signing key of kahog-kadup = bky13_6wLyxnPsJob4P

**Build Provenance — Stale-Cache Postmortem (Glimmerfen)**

After the stale-cache incident, every Glimmerfen cache-layer deploy must carry verifiable provenance. On-call: before rolling back or forward, check that the artifact's attestation matches what the registry reports; the bug shipped because an unsigned hotfix image bypassed this check. Mismatches block the deploy and page the Keelworth rotation. The attested build currently serving production traffic is recorded below.

pipeline stamp: htk21_104c5ba7d0df6b2897cd5